What affects the price

When you need electrical work, the final bill depends on a few specific things. The total cost typically reflects the complexity of your home’s wiring, the quality of materials selected, and how much time the job takes to complete safely. If your main panel needs an upgrade, or if the technician has to open up walls to reach hidden lines, labor hours will naturally go up. Conversely, simple fixture swaps or minor switch repairs are generally more straightforward and budget-friendly. We know you want a clear idea of what to expect before anyone starts. What is a weatherproof electrical box?

A weatherproof electrical box is designed to protect electrical connections and devices from moisture, dust, and other environmental factors. These are crucial for any electrical installation located outdoors or in damp areas. In Athens-Clarke County, this would include outdoor lighting, power outlets for patios, or equipment in garages. Using a properly rated weatherproof box ensures the safety and longevity of the electrical components, preventing short circuits and corrosion. What is electrical wire?

Electrical wire is a conductor, typically made of copper or aluminum, used to carry electric current. It's insulated to prevent the current from escaping and causing hazards. In Athens-Clarke County, various types and gauges of electrical wire are used depending on the application, such as powering lights, appliances, or larger machinery. The correct type and size of wire are crucial for safe and efficient electrical system design.
